Is there a flower called star?

The orange star plant (Ornithogalum dubium) is a perennial flowering plant belonging to the Asparagaceae family. Also known as the star of Bethlehem and sun star plant, the orange star plant gets its name from its star-shaped, bright orange flowers.

What is a galaxy flower?

A galaxy flower’s botanical name is petunia cultivars. A type of petunia—just like the colorful, fragrant blooms you see draped from hanging baskets—galaxy flowers are a deep purple. They earned their name due to the white spots speckled on their petals, which look like the stars of the Milky Way.

Is there a morning star flower?

Calibrachoa ‘Superbells Morning Star’ is a compact, bushy or slightly trailing perennial, usually grown as an annual, boasting masses of blush pink flowers adorned with a yellow star from late spring to the first frosts.

What does a starflower look like?

Ipheion ‘Jessie’ (Spring Starflower) is a small bulbous perennial with sweetly scented, star-shaped, deep blue flowers, up to 1.5 in. (4 cm), adorned with a darker stripe on each petal. Blooming in mid to late spring, the dainty blooms rise atop a foliage of onion-scented, narrowly strap-shaped, light green leaves.

Is lily same as stargazer?

Lilium ‘Stargazer’ (the ‘Stargazer lily’) is a hybrid lily of the ‘Oriental group’. Oriental lilies are known for their fragrant perfume, blooming mid-to-late summer. Stargazers are easy to grow and do best in full sunlight.
